Summary
HR0350 is a House Resolution introduced in the Illinois House of Representatives to honor Maureen Kahn on her retirement from her position as president and CEO of Blessing Health System. The resolution highlights her significant contributions to the healthcare sector in Illinois, particularly her leadership at Blessing Hospital over more than two decades. It outlines her tenure, starting from her appointment as president and CEO in 2014, and acknowledges her previous positions that showcase her extensive experience and dedication to the healthcare industry.
